Cargo ship KINGSBOROUGH, 3,368grt (Kingsborough Shipping Co. P.D.Hendry & Sons mngrs). Built 1928 at Lithgows, Glasgow. Had an eventful war career serving in North Atlantic & Mediterranean convoys as well as coastal convoys and part of the D-Day landings. Sold 1947 renamed BASFORD (J.German & Son). Sold 1952 renamed IZMIT (Kisinbay Biraderler).
